Output 4010629f8bcbab35b4ed1456cad4a61cc215d96eded0e05bac6b1c1fb7516b73:9

value
200640523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f6b5021edb8f2f1f173e182a5aecbca108ed3d OP_EQUAL
address
MBucqBkaqGY3Hk9ffGLWTVX89ngcEnya44
transaction
4010629f8bcbab35b4ed1456cad4a61cc215d96eded0e05bac6b1c1fb7516b73
spent
true